The New Chums Arrival On A Gold Diggings

c1865. Hand-coloured lithograph, text including title below image, 23.6 x 28.3cm. Cropped top margin. Framed.

Text includes “Distance lends enchantment to the view is exquisitely verified in the opinion a new arrival, or in Colonial parlance, a New Chum…a young gentleman remarks in a colonial song: ‘I’ve got to work with all my might, and throw up nasty clay, if my mother could but see me now, whatever would she say.’” From the collection Sketches of Australian Life & Scenery: Complete in 12 plates, London: Messrs Newbold & Co., c1865. Held in NGA.
